High School Cheerleader Dies At Practice
High School Cheerleader Dies At Practice - News Story - WPXI Pittsburgh

YOUNGSTOWN, Oh. -- Instead of celebrating her birthday, an Ohio family is mourning the death of their daughter who suddenly collapsed at cheerleading practice.

Jabraya Howell cheers for East High School in Youngstown. She collapsed at practice yesterday and never regained consciousness.

Her family and friends released balloons on what would have been her 17th birthday.

Jabraya had asthma and bronchitis, but her family said she was given a clean bill of health at a physical last month.

"It was so unexpected, so unexpected, and it wasn't like we had gotten in to any vigorous routine. She wasn't overworked or anything," said Annie Terry, cheerleading advisor.

An autopsy is planned for tomorrow to determine her exact cause of death.

She will be buried on Halloween.
